When You're Exhausted

Do you ever feel like you have no emotions? Maybe, you've been facing a challenge, an "impossible situation" for so long, it has taken all the life out of you. You're left with nothing. You're exhausted. It seems that your spirit is gone, your ability to get up and move is missing.

The fact is that this day was coming. You would like to deny it, but we are human, and humans get tired and discouraged and drained. The question is what do we do now? Do we wait things out? Do we quit trying? Is it okay to give up when we are left with nothing?

We need to remember some things. Our life is our message. Why did we try in the first place? What was our reason for persevering when our first disappointment appeared?

Someone once said, "Go to sleep with a dream, wake up with a purpose." When you wake up tomorrow, find your purpose. Remind yourself of your why. Don't give up.
